Re the welded hinges - I can only presume they were concerned the hinges may drop over time if the bolts loosened, so welded the hinges to the B posts. Absolute pain in the bum though as I had to (very carefully0 cut through the welds with an angle grinder to get the hinges off as they all needed new pins, except the right rear which was ok and left in place - it has become my datum point for the doors/front wings/ bonnet etc. If anybody is thinking of doing the same and their existing panel gaps are OK, then do try to keep one of the rear hinges in situ unless it is wrecked - they don't get opened that often so the pins may not be particularly worn. When you offer up repaired/replaced doors and front wings, at least you can get them back to the same place as they were originally; otherwise it is a right faff!!
